A recruitment agency is seeking a Branch Manager in Worcester. This role requires 5 years of recruitment experience and a proven track record in sales and branch development. You will lead the team, manage client relationships, and drive business growth, while ensuring operational excellence.
The position offers a competitive salary ranging from £40,000 to £45,000, along with an uncapped commission structure and excellent career progression opportunities. Ideal for someone ready to make an immediate impact.

How to prepare for a job interview at Local Proud Hampton Roads
✨Know Your Numbers
As a Recruitment Branch Leader, you'll need to demonstrate your sales prowess. Be ready to discuss your previous sales figures, branch growth metrics, and any successful strategies you've implemented. This shows you’re not just talk; you’ve got the results to back it up!
✨Showcase Leadership Skills
Prepare examples of how you've led teams in the past. Think about challenges you've faced and how you motivated your team to overcome them. This role is all about leadership, so make sure you highlight your ability to inspire and drive performance.
✨Understand Client Relationships
Client management is key in this role. Be prepared to discuss how you've built and maintained strong client relationships. Share specific examples of how you've turned challenging clients into loyal partners, as this will show your potential employer that you can drive business growth.
✨Research the Company Culture
Before the interview, take some time to understand the company’s culture and values. This will help you tailor your responses to align with what they’re looking for. Plus, it shows that you’re genuinely interested in being part of their team and making an immediate impact.
